I heard about Grand Duke Martines repeatedly failing the knights’ examination not from Prince Tessler himself, but from Kanal Adalion—the swordmaster who had trained both of them.
Kanal Adalion was the captain of the royal knights and one of the greatest sword masters in the history of the Shattonil Kingdom.
And he was also my secret swordsmanship instructor.
Ever since I became aware of the divine presence within me, I secretly began practicing swordsmanship to relieve the searing heat coursing through my body.
Noble young ladies of the Shattonil Kingdom learn basic swordsmanship from childhood.
Most noble young ladies dabble halfheartedly and soon abandon their training, but the moment I grasped a sword, I felt a shiver run through my entire body.
Master Kanal had long been acquainted with my family, the House of Count Trova, and thus taught swordsmanship to my stepbrothers.
I used to wander around the count’s training hall, secretly watching and mimicking Master Kanal’s lessons.
One day, he caught sight of me practicing alone in the hall and accepted me as his disciple.
However, the fact that I received personal instruction from him remained a secret—his own suggestion, made out of concern for my stepbrothers’ hostility.
Thus, several years passed, and I turned sixteen.
